About the Author | Melinda Clougherty is a speech and language pathologist with 29 years of experience working in the public schools. In 2008, she published two guessing games, "Are You in the Doghouse?" and "What's Your Wish?" through School Specialty. In 2011, she published her first book, "Riddled with Riddles," a reproducible classroom activity manual designed to promote critical thinking. Her most recent publication, "Logic for Laughs," was written as a companion book to provide more classroom activities for inferential and deductive reasoning skills. |
